About Boris Belhomme

Boris Belhomme is a scholar working on Renewable Energy, Sustainability and the Environment, Artificial Intelligence and Management Science and Operations Research, having authored 8 papers that have together received 327 indexed citations. Recurring topics across this work include Solar Thermal and Photovoltaic Systems (7 papers), Photovoltaic System Optimization Techniques (6 papers) and Solar Radiation and Photovoltaics (4 papers). The work is most often cited by research in Renewable Energy, Sustainability and the Environment (291 citations), Artificial Intelligence (157 citations) and Electrical and Electronic Engineering (108 citations). Boris Belhomme has collaborated with scholars based in Germany and United States. Frequent co-authors include Robert Pitz‐Paal, Peter Schwarzbözl, Steffen Ulmer, Wolfgang Reinalter, Christoph Prahl, Robert Flesch, Joel Andersson and Tobias Hirsch. Their work appears in journals such as Solar Energy, Journal of Solar Energy Engineering and elib (German Aerospace Center).
